HAINES v. USA
Filing
14
Order: Plaintiff has both failed to comply with the court's instructions and has failed to prosecute his claims. Therefore, pursuant to RCFC 41(b), plaintiff's complaint is DISMISSED without prejudice. The Clerk is directed to enter judgment. Signed by Senior Judge Marian Blank Horn.
